Minister Nusron Invites Regional Heads Throughout Southeast Sulawesi to Collaborate to Overcome Challenges in Realizing Modern Land Administration.

KENDARI, POSINTERNASIONAL.COM.

Minister of Agrarian Affairs and Spatial Planning/Head of the National Land Agency (ATR/BPN), Nusron Wahid, on Wednesday (05/28/2025), invited regional heads in Southeast Sulawesi to collaborate to realize a modern and inclusive land administration system.

The system consists of four main clusters, namely land tenure, land value, land use, and land development.

In its implementation, challenges will emerge and these can be better overcome if all parties are involved, including the regional government (Pemda).

“We cannot do this without collaborating. With whom? With the local government, with regional heads, be it governors, regents and mayors.

“He emphasized in the Land and Spatial Planning Coordination Meeting with the Provincial Government and Districts/Cities throughout Southeast Sulawesi, in the Pola Bahteramas Room of the Southeast Sulawesi Governor’s Office”, said.

Minister Nusron said that he had visited 15 provinces to build synergy in implementing various land and spatial planning programs.

Some of them are Agrarian Reform, Land Acquisition, and spatial planning. Southeast Sulawesi is the 16th province he has visited with the hope of strengthening collaboration.

In terms of Agrarian Reform, for example, Minister Nusron hopes that the coordination carried out by the Ministry of ATR/BPN and the Southeast Sulawesi Provincial Government can be strengthened.

“Considering that regional heads also serve ex-officio as Chair of the Agrarian Reform Task Force (GTRA). This is to be clear, so that there is joint responsibility,” he concluded.

He further explained that the local government is the one that plays a role in determining the subject of land benefits.

“It is our job to determine the land objects that will undergo Agrarian Reform. However, it is the job of the Regional Heads to determine the subjects, who will receive Agrarian Reform,” said Minister Nusron.

On this occasion, Minister Nusron also handed over land certificates for regional government assets, consisting of 5 certificates for Southeast Sulawesi Provincial Government assets and 71 certificates for Regency Government assets throughout Southeast Sulawesi.

He also handed over land certificates for waqf to representatives of religious institutions who were present.

The 10 waqf certificates and houses of worship that were handed over this time consisted of 6 certificates for mosques, 1 certificate for prayer rooms, 1 certificate for churches, and 2 certificates for temples.

At this moment, Minister Nusron explained about land and spatial planning matters, handed over certificates from the results of the ATR/BPN Ministry program, and opened a discussion session to discuss strategic issues in Southeast Sulawesi.
